INTERNATIONAL LAW FIRMS RUN TOGETHER WITH THE IBJ-IJE AND THE BRUSSELS BAR TO SUPPORT UNE NOTE POUR CHACUN

On 27 May 2012, more than 380 lawyers and staff from national and international law firms in Brussels will once again join together as a single team to participate in the annual 20 km run through Brussels.

Now in its eighth year, this charitable initiative, better known as the "Legal Run", has become a unique tradition within the Brussels legal community. Each participating firm sponsors its own runners and over the past seven years the Legal Run has raised approximately EUR 110,000 for charity.

This year, the Legal Run is supporting Une Note Pour Chacun, an organization that helps hospitalized children or children with a disability to forget about their health problems through musical activities such as musical entertainment, concerts, learning to play or build an instrument, or compose a song - a playful learning programme which can serve as a therapeutic aid or simply a way of bringing a smile to the face of a child in distress. Some 559 runners from the Institute for company lawyers (IBJ-IJE), the Brussels Bar and 33 law firms have confirmed their participation in this year's event.
